Q-CTRL Unveils Fire Opal Quantum-Dynamics Simulator, Solving Complex Materials Science Problems 3,000x Faster than Classical Computers

Q-CTRL Australia
Overview
Q-CTRL has launched ‘Fire Opal,’ quantum computer performance management software that significantly enhances its ability to simulate complex quantum mechanical interactions in materials science. A demonstration on the IBM Quantum Platform showed Fire Opal could solve real-world materials discovery problems 3,000 times faster than existing classical software. This dramatic speedup marks a breakthrough in overcoming material development bottlenecks and enabling faster innovation.

Technical & Business Details: Quantum Computer Performance Management and Real-World Application

Fire Opal is built upon Q-CTRL’s proprietary technology for managing and mitigating noise and errors in quantum computers. This allows for more reliable computations even with limited quantum resources. Simulating quantum dynamics in materials science is crucial for areas requiring detailed atomic and molecular understanding, such as catalyst reactions, superconductivity, and predicting the behavior of new battery materials. Fire Opal achieves significant time reductions in solving these complex problems, which would otherwise take classical supercomputers an immense amount of time. For example, in analyzing the electronic structure or reaction pathways of specific molecules, where traditional simulations might take months, Fire Opal can potentially generate comparable or superior results in just a few days.

Background & Context: Quantum Computing’s Application to Materials Science and Expectations for Practical Use

Quantum computing holds immense promise for fields like drug discovery and materials science due to its high computational power. Specifically, its ability to directly model quantum mechanical phenomena can yield insights previously unattainable with classical computational methods. However, the practical application of quantum computers has been hindered by high error rates and scalability challenges. Performance management software like Q-CTRL’s Fire Opal is essential for overcoming these hurdles and accelerating the industrial adoption of quantum computing.
